Christmas cooks are being reminded not to wash the turkey before roasting it. Definitely, don't wash it, there's no need to wash it. "Open the packaging on the tray that you're going to be roasting it in. Do add whatever seasoning is your preference to add and put it straight in the oven. "Then wash your hands and any utensils that came into contact with the turkey."
Source: Irish Examiner December 25, 2018 10:18 UTC